The Garden of Friends: Ode to the Sea

Each spring, The Leiber Collection welcomes the season with The Garden of Friends, an annual outdoor exhibition set within the Leiber Sculpture Garden. This beloved series celebrates an outstanding group of East End artists whose work reflects the region’s rich creative legacy and deep connection to the natural landscape. Thoughtfully integrated throughout the garden, the artworks invite visitors to experience art in dialogue with nature, encouraging reflection, discovery, and a sense of community.

Judith and Gerson Leiber: A Passion For Fashion

The Leiber Collection is pleased to present Judith and Gerson Leiber: A Passion for Fashion, a vibrant exhibition celebrating the extraordinary creative partnership between Judith Leiber, renowned for her iconic handbags, and Gerson Leiber, an accomplished abstract and fashion painter. Opening on Saturday, May 30, from 2 to 5 PM, the exhibition explores the shared artistic life of Judith and Gerson Leiber, shaped by a deep and enduring commitment to beauty, craftsmanship, and imagination.

Gerson Leiber: An Inexplicable Light

The Leiber Collection is proud to present Gerson Leiber: An Inexplicable Light, a poignant exhibition honoring the late artist’s final decade of work and culminating in his last painting, An Inexplicable Light. This deeply personal presentation offers a rare and intimate look at Gerson Leiber’s enduring exploration of abstraction, color, and form in the years leading up to his passing.

Gerson Leiber: The Poetry of Geometry and Color

The Leiber Collection is pleased to present Gerson Leiber: The Poetry of Geometry and Color, an exhibition celebrating a dynamic decade in the career of artist Gerson Leiber. This focused presentation brings together works that reflect Leiber’s immersion in abstraction and his dialogue with modernist movements that fused emotion, geometry, and color into poetic visual form.
